Description Using PAR-CLIP, a technology which allows the direct and transcriptome-wide identification of miRNA targets, we delineate the target sites for all viral and cellular miRNAs expressed in PEL cell lines. The resulting data set revealed that KSHV miRNAs directly target more than 2000 cellular mRNAs, including many involved in pathways relevant to KSHV pathogenesis. Moreover, 58% of these mRNAs are also targeted by EBV miRNAs, via distinct binding sites.Clusters with seed matches to expressed miRNAs were considered candidate target sites. Of the clusters mapping to human 3'UTRs, 69% (BC-1) and 70% (BC-3) had seed matches to expressed miRNAs (Tables S6).Table S6B BC-3 derived 3'UTR clusters with seed matches to expressed miRNAs.
